Performance Engines for Sports Cars
Efficiency engines for sporting activities automobiles are especially engineered to provide improved agility, rate, and power, establishing them apart from basic vehicle engines. These engines frequently use innovative modern technologies such as turbocharging, turbo charging, and variable shutoff timing to make the most of effectiveness and responsiveness.
Generally, performance engines are developed with higher compression ratios, which enable better power extraction from fuel. This causes remarkable horse power and torque figures, making it possible for quick velocity and greater full throttle. Moreover, the lightweight materials made use of in these engines, such as aluminum and carbon fiber, add to lowered general lorry weight, enhancing handling and ability to move.
Engine configurations like V6, V8, and also hybrid systems are usual in performance cars, each offering special benefits in regards to power delivery and driving characteristics. The tuning of these engines is additionally vital; numerous suppliers enhance the engine management systems to supply an exciting driving experience, frequently consisting of sport settings that change throttle feedback and gear changes.
Reliable Engines for Daily Commuters
In the realm of everyday travelling, effective engines play a crucial function in maximizing fuel economic situation and reducing discharges while providing reputable efficiency. As city populations grow and ecological concerns increase, the need for cars furnished with reliable powertrains has surged.
Modern engines created for day-to-day commuters typically include modern technologies such as turbocharging, direct fuel injection, and hybrid systems. Turbocharging improves engine performance forcibly more air into the combustion chamber, enabling more information smaller sized, lighter engines that do not endanger power result. Straight gas injection improves fuel atomization, leading to better combustion and boosted effectiveness.
Hybrid engines, combining inner burning with electric power, additional increase gas economic situation, particularly in stop-and-go traffic, where conventional engines can experience from ineffectiveness. Electric motors help during acceleration and can run individually at reduced rates, minimizing general fuel consumption.
Moreover, advancements in engine management systems and lightweight products contribute considerably to efficient engine layout. By concentrating on performance, sturdiness, and environmental sustainability, manufacturers proceed to provide engines that not only fulfill the demands of daily travelling however also straighten with worldwide efforts to lower carbon impacts.
Heavy-Duty Engines for Work Autos
Durable engines for work lorries are regularly crafted to supply outstanding torque and dependability under demanding problems. These engines are designed to execute in atmospheres where conventional engines might falter, such as building and construction websites, logging procedures, and farming settings. The key focus of sturdy engines is their ability to create high levels of power while maintaining sturdiness over extended durations of operation.
Normally, heavy-duty engines make use of advanced products and durable construction methods to withstand the roughness of hefty workloads. Functions such as enhanced cyndrical tube blocks, enhanced air conditioning systems, and progressed gas injection innovations add to their effectiveness. These engines commonly run at lower RPMs, which assists to maximize gas efficiency while offering the needed power for transporting and lugging.
Along with mechanical toughness, sturdy engines are often geared up with advanced digital control devices (ECUs) that take care of efficiency, exhausts, and diagnostics. This integration enables much better surveillance and upkeep, ensuring that job vehicles remain efficient and operational.
Ultimately, heavy-duty engines are an important element in the efficiency of different industries, offering the required power and reliability to tackle the toughest of tasks.
